编程实现文案图片可以通过以下几种方法:
使用像素点
将文字拆分为一个个像素点,通过编程语言设定像素点的位置和颜色,从而绘制出文字图像。
使用ASCII字符
将文字转换为ASCII字符,然后通过编程语言将这些字符打印出来,呈现出文字图像。
使用深度学习模型
利用深度学习模型(如生成对抗网络GAN、变分自编码器VAE等)生成与文本内容匹配的图片。
使用HTML/CSS和JavaScript
通过这些前端技术,可以实现基本的文字识别和放置,结合`pytesseract`和`PIL`等库来处理图像和文字。
使用自动化脚本
编写脚本来批量生成含有指定内容的图片,可以调整文字内容、字体、颜色等样式。
使用模板引擎
通过模板引擎将文案的生成与代码逻辑分离,提高代码的可读性和维护性。
使用在线设计平台
利用Canva等在线设计平台,输入文案即可生成精美的图片。
使用专业设计软件
如Adobe Photoshop,结合其强大的图像处理功能来设计包含文案的图片。
建议
选择合适的方法:根据具体需求和技能水平选择合适的方法。例如,初学者可以从简单的像素点或ASCII字符开始,有编程基础后可以考虑使用深度学习模型或在线设计平台。
学习资源:利用在线教程、文档和开源项目来学习编程实现文案图片的技术。例如,可以查看GitHub上的相关项目代码,或参加在线课程学习深度学习模型的使用。
实践项目:通过实际项目来巩固所学知识,可以从简单的文字图片生成开始,逐步尝试更复杂的效果和需求。